About Ronalane, Alberta

Ronalane is a locality in 9-13-12-W4, Alberta, Canada. It is classified as a village / hamlet. Ronalane is located at 50.0683°N, 111.5953°W. It observes Mountain Time (UTC−7 / −6). Postal code area: T1G.

Ronalane sits held within the stark, eroded embrace of the Bad Land Hills, where the earth yields to a raw and weathered geometry. It lies 50.8 km north-east of Taber, AB (from Taber, AB: bearing 51°T), and is situated 14.5 km east-south-east of Hays.
